Jump to content

Having a problem scanning libraries


Recommended Posts

Posted (edited)

Hello,
I'm not able to scan libraries for new videos.

Currently on latest beta 4.4.0.24 but was on latest stable 4.3.1.0.

Not sure if this makes a difference. In the Emby embyserver.txt log there is a 32 digit number in it resembling a key that is  different from my Emby Premiere Key (random key ahead). localhost:8096/emby/Users/1886449c581c801f2ab4e45cb76f06b8
 
 "ALERTS" ON DASHBOARD.
Exception of type 'SQLitePCL.pretty.SQLiteException' was thrown.
at SQLitePCL.pretty.SQLiteException.CheckOk(sqlite3 db, Int32 rc)
at SQLitePCL.pretty.StatementImpl.MoveNext()
at SQLitePCL.pretty.DatabaseConnection.Execute(IDatabaseConnection This, ReadOnlySpan`1 sqlUtf8)
at SQLitePCL.pretty.DatabaseConnection.RollbackTransaction(IDatabaseConnection This)
at Emby.Server.Implementations.Data.SqliteItemRepository.DeleteItems(Int64[] ids)
at Emby.Server.Implementations.Data.SqliteItemRepository.DeleteItem(BaseItem item, CancellationToken cancellationToken)
at Emby.Server.Implementations.Library.LibraryManager.DeleteItem(BaseItem item, DeleteOptions options, BaseItem parent, Boolean notifyParentItem)
at MediaBrowser.Controller.Entities.Folder.ValidateChildrenInternal(IProgress`1 progress, CancellationToken cancellationToken, Boolean recursive, Boolean refreshChildMetadata, MetadataRefreshOptions refreshOptions, IDirectoryService directoryService)
at Emby.Server.Implementations.Library.LibraryManager.ValidateTopLibraryFolders(CancellationToken cancellationToken)
at Emby.Server.Implementations.Library.LibraryManager.PerformLibraryValidation(IProgress`1 progress, CancellationToken cancellationToken)
at Emby.Server.Implementations.Library.LibraryManager.ValidateMediaLibraryInternal(IProgress`1 progress, CancellationToken cancellationToken)
at Emby.Server.Implementations.ScheduledTasks.ScheduledTaskWorker.ExecuteInternal(TaskOptions options)
****************************************************************************
****************************************************************************
ERROR IN SERVER LOG
2020-03-12 00:18:21.549 Error ProviderManager: Error refreshing item
    *** Error Report ***
    Version: 4.4.0.24
    Command line: C:\Users\huckn\AppData\Roaming\Emby-Server\system\EmbyServer.dll
    Operating system: Microsoft Windows NT 6.2.9200.0
    64-Bit OS: True
    64-Bit Process: True
    User Interactive: True
    Runtime: file:///C:/Users/huckn/AppData/Roaming/Emby-Server/system/System.Private.CoreLib.dll
    System.Environment.Version: 3.1.2
    Processor count: 8
    Program data path: C:\Users\huckn\AppData\Roaming\Emby-Server\programdata
    Application directory: C:\Users\huckn\AppData\Roaming\Emby-Server\system
    SQLitePCL.pretty.SQLiteException: Error: cannot rollback - no transaction is active
    SQLitePCL.pretty.SQLiteException: Exception of type 'SQLitePCL.pretty.SQLiteException' was thrown.
       at SQLitePCL.pretty.SQLiteException.CheckOk(sqlite3 db, Int32 rc)
       at SQLitePCL.pretty.StatementImpl.MoveNext()
       at SQLitePCL.pretty.DatabaseConnection.Execute(IDatabaseConnection This, ReadOnlySpan`1 sqlUtf8)
       at SQLitePCL.pretty.DatabaseConnection.RollbackTransaction(IDatabaseConnection This)
       at Emby.Server.Implementations.Data.SqliteItemRepository.SaveItems(List`1 items, CancellationToken cancellationToken)
       at Emby.Server.Implementations.Library.LibraryManager.CreateItems(List`1 items, BaseItem parent, CancellationToken cancellationToken)
       at MediaBrowser.Controller.Entities.Folder.ValidateChildrenInternal(IProgress`1 progress, CancellationToken cancellationToken, Boolean recursive, Boolean refreshChildMetadata, MetadataRefreshOptions refreshOptions, IDirectoryService directoryService)
       at MediaBrowser.Controller.Entities.Folder.ValidateSubFolders(BaseItem[] children, IDirectoryService directoryService, IProgress`1 progress, CancellationToken cancellationToken)
       at MediaBrowser.Controller.Entities.Folder.ValidateChildrenInternal(IProgress`1 progress, CancellationToken cancellationToken, Boolean recursive, Boolean refreshChildMetadata, MetadataRefreshOptions refreshOptions, IDirectoryService directoryService)
       at MediaBrowser.Providers.Manager.ProviderManager.RefreshItem(BaseItem item, MetadataRefreshOptions options, CancellationToken cancellationToken)
       at MediaBrowser.Providers.Manager.ProviderManager.StartProcessingRefreshQueue()
    Source: SQLitePCL.pretty
    TargetSite: Void CheckOk(SQLitePCL.sqlite3, Int32)

 

vYgNAFF.png

Edited by spm
Posted

Hi there @@spm can you please attach the emby server log? Thanks !

Posted

Hi Luke,
I went ahead and did a full reinstall. The library had four folders in it. Two recorded movies and two recorded shows that I couldn't delete in dashboard and don't recall putting there. About a month ago I put IPTV in with HDhomerun didn't like it and removed IPTV. Last night I noticed live TV guide still had all the IPTV channel icons. Decided I gunched it up...

So I'm all good but please let me know if you see something in log I should be concerned about.

Thanks again

Posted

Ok thanks for the feedback. I don't see anything obvious in the log file so we would have had to dig deeper to get to the bottom of it.

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...